<code draggable="kq5qa"></code><font dir="vj9nh"></font><ins lang="byb9s"></ins><b date-time="w9p_q"></b><legend dir="pk_0o"></legend><sub draggable="v5l7u"></sub><i id="456vh"></i><small lang="ecbyg"></small><small dir="virwq"></small><pre dropzone="v04zf"></pre><dfn dir="upwuh"></dfn><strong date-time="7_8mc"></strong><pre draggable="d9spz"></pre><del draggable="i76hk"></del><noscript draggable="3dmue"></noscript><noframes draggable="ynxwu">

    比特币(Bitcoin)作为一种加密数字货币,在其运作中涉及许多复杂的概念和技术,其中钱包签名是理解比特币交易和安全性的重要组成部分。本文将深入探讨比特币钱包签名的本质、原理、作用,以及它在比特币生态系统中的重要性。同时,我们将为您解答关于比特币钱包签名的五个相关问题,帮助您更全面地理解这一关键概念。

    什么是比特币钱包签名?

    比特币钱包签名是一种用于验证消息或交易的加密机制。它通过数字签名技术来确保交易的真实性和完整性。每当用户发起一笔比特币交易时,钱包软件会使用用户的私钥对交易信息进行签名。这样的签名不仅证明了这笔交易确实是由拥有相应比特币的用户发起的;同时,还可以防止交易信息在传输过程中被篡改。

    数字签名的核心在于一对密钥——私钥和公钥。私钥是一个秘密的字符串,仅由用户掌握,而公钥则是可以公开分享的,它与私钥是数学上相关联的。用户通过私钥生成一个唯一的数字签名,接收方接收到交易后,可以使用相应的公钥进行验证,确保签名的有效性。

    比特币钱包签名的工作原理

    比特币钱包签名的工作原理可以分为以下几个步骤:

    1. 创建交易:用户在比特币钱包中输入交易信息,如接收者地址和转账金额等,创建一笔新的交易。
    2. 生成哈希值:钱包软件对交易信息进行哈希计算,生成一个唯一的哈希值。哈希值是交易内容的数字指纹,任何微小的修改都会导致哈希值的变化。
    3. 数字签名:用户使用自己的私钥对生成的哈希值进行加密,形成数字签名。这个签名是独一无二的,且与交易信息紧密关联。
    4. 广播交易:将交易信息和数字签名一起广播到比特币网络中,其他节点会接收到该交易信息。
    5. 验证签名:网络中的节点(也称为矿工)使用交易发起者的公钥来验证数字签名,确保签名的合法性以及交易信息的完整性。

    比特币钱包签名的作用与重要性

    比特币钱包签名在整个比特币网络中发挥着至关重要的作用,主要体现在以下几个方面:

    • 安全性:签名确保了只有持有相关私钥的用户才能发起交易,这大大增强了比特币交易的安全性。
    • 完整性:签名与交易信息进行绑定,任何对交易内容的篡改都会导致签名无效,从而确保交易信息的完整性。
    • 不可否认性:一旦交易被签名并且成功广播到网络,发起者不能否认其交易,因为签名是由其私钥生成的,具有不可反驳的特性。
    • 去中心化:比特币网络不依赖于任何中心化的机构进行签名和验证,所有交易都依赖于去中心化的节点网络,保持了比特币作为一种去中心化货币的特点。

    比特币钱包签名的细致理解是自信参与比特币交易、投资及其相关活动的基础。接下来,我们将进一步解答一些关于比特币钱包签名常见的问题,以便加深读者对该主题的理解。

    比特币钱袋的私钥和公钥是什么?有什么区别?

    比特币钱包中的私钥和公钥是加密货币交易的核心,理解这两个概念对于安全地使用比特币至关重要。

    私钥:私钥是一个由随机数生成的、非常长的字符串,它是个人比特币账户的钥匙。用户必须严格保管自己的私钥,因为拥有私钥的人可以完全控制与之关联的所有比特币。对于任何比特币交易,私钥的作用是签名,证明用户的身份和交易的有效性。如果私钥被他人获取,用户的比特币资产可能会面临被盗的风险。

    公钥:公钥是由私钥生成的另一段加密字符串,可以公开分享。人与人之间进行比特币交易时,发送比特币的用户会共享其公钥或者更常使用的比特币地址。这使得他人在比特币网络上识别及发送比特币给这个公钥所代表的钱包。

    区别:私钥是需要保密的,任何知道私钥的人都可以支配比特币;而公钥则是可以公开的,任何人都可以在网络中找到与之对应的比特币地址进行转账。在实际操作中,公钥的安全性是基于私钥的不可逆性,即由公钥推算出私钥几乎是不可能的,这是基于现代计算的加密学基础。

    比特币交易如何确保安全性?

    比特币交易的安全性主要通过加密技术、交易签名、区块链技术和去中心化特性来保证。

    加密技术:比特币使用先进的加密算法,如SHA-256,确保交易信息在网络中传输时的机密性和安全性,避免数据被窃听或篡改。

    交易签名:每笔比特币交易都需要通过发送者的私钥进行数字签名,确保交易的发起者为合法持有者。签名还确保交易信息的完整性,一旦交易信息被修改,签名会失效,防止欺诈。

    区块链技术:比特币运行在区块链技术上,其具有不可篡改性。区块链将所有的交易记录在一个公共账本上,并通过众多节点进行验证,确保数据的透明和安全。

    去中心化机制:比特币网络没有任何中央管理机构,而是通过每个参与节点共同维护,每个节点独立地记录和验证交易,这降低了单点故障的风险,提高了整个系统的安全性。

    此外,良好的安全实践,如定期备份钥匙文件、使用多重签名钱包、启用两步验证等,也有助于提高比特币持有者的安全性。

    如果我遗失了比特币钱包的私钥怎么办?

    遗失比特币钱包的私钥会导致用户无法访问其比特币资产。这是一种非常常见的风险,因此了解应对措施是很重要的。

    首先,建议用户在创建比特币钱包时,务必做好私钥的备份。可以通过多种方式进行备份,例如写在纸上、使用硬件钱包或密码管理工具等。而且,私钥备份应保存在一个安全、远离网络的地方,以防止被黑客攻击。

    如果已经丢失了私钥,并且没有备份,那么用户将无法找回钱包中的比特币。比特币的系统设计就是为了保障安全,因此没有“重置密码”或“找回私钥”的功能。用户的比特币将会永久地停留在这个钱包地址中,直到该地址进入一个新的用户的控制之下。

    总之,预防是解决遗失私钥问题的最佳方法,因此使用安全的存储方式、定期备份,并使用知名度高的、受信赖的钱包软件,可以有效降低丢失私钥的风险。

    比特币交易的确认过程是怎样的?

    比特币交易确认是一个包含多个步骤及时间因素的过程,关系到交易的最终有效性。

    首先,当用户在比特币网络上发起交易时,该交易会被广播到整个网络,成为“未确认交易”。每个节点会接受到交易信息并将其临时保存在内存池中。

    其次,矿工节点会从内存池中挑选交易以打包到新的区块中,然后通过计算复杂的数学算法(即挖矿)来生成区块。达到一定条件的区块(通过哈希验证)便可以被矿工确认并添加到区块链中。这一过程通常会需要算力竞争,以及一定的时间,一般在10分钟左右。

    之后,区块被确认后,新的区块以及其中的交易信息会传播到所有节点,更新他们的区块链数据库。这时,交易通过了第一次确认。

    为了提高安全性,通常建议用户在交易所或商家接收到比特币后,等待更高数量的确认(通常是6次确认),以防止双重支付攻击等风险。在此之后,交易将被视为有效,无法逆转或撤销。

    使用比特币钱包时应该注意哪些常见的安全问题?

    使用比特币钱包时,用户需要警惕众多安全问题,以确保个人资产的安全。

    私钥保护:私钥是比特币最核心的部分,确保其不被他人获知是至关重要的。使用硬件钱包、纸钱包等安全的私钥存储方式,并避免在不安全的网络环境中输入私钥。

    警惕网络钓鱼:网络钓鱼攻击是常见的诈骗手法。用户应谨慎点击链接、下载未知文件,不要随意提供个人信息或私钥,确保使用的交易平台及服务是官方可信的。

    软件更新:保持比特币钱包和相关软件的更新,利用每次更新带来的安全修复和新功能,以抵御潜在的漏洞和风险。

    备份与恢复:定期备份钱包文件,记录助记词,了解钱包的恢复流程,以防钱包丢失或损坏带来的资产损失。

    多重签名钱包:如果是大额操作,建议使用多重签名钱包,这需要多个密钥的签名才能完成一笔交易,为资产提供额外的安全屏障。

    通过注重这些安全细节,用户可以在使用比特币钱包时有效减少风险,确保资产的安全。

    总之,比特币钱包签名不仅是加密货币交易的保障,也是理解比特币金融体系的重要基础。希望通过以上的阐述,能够帮助您更深入地理解比特币钱包签名以及相关的问题。